资源简介
msp430g2553与串口通信的驱动程序
把传输缓存的数据放入到接收缓存,而且楼主也硬件上将RX与TX跳脚进行了连接,如此一来就可以才调试程序里面

代码片段和文件信息
#include “msp430G2553.h“
#include “stdio.h“
void main(void)
{
WDTCTL = WDTPW + WDTHOLD; //停止看门狗
UCA0CTL1 |= UCSWRST; // USCI_A0 进入软件复位状态
UCA0CTL1 |= UCSSEL_2; //时钟源选择 SMCLK
BCSCTL1 = CALBC1_1MHZ; //设置 DCO 频率为 1MHz
DCOCTL = CALDCO_1MHZ;
P1SEL = BIT1 + BIT2 ; // P1.1 = RXD P1.2=TXD
P1SEL2 = BIT1 + BIT2 ; // P1.1 = RXD P1.2=TXD
P1DIR |= BIT0;
UCA0BR0 = 0x68; //时钟源 1MHz 时波特率为9600
UCA0BR1 = 0x00; //时钟源 1MHz 时波特率为9600
UCA0MCTL = UCBRS0; //小数分频器
UCA0CTL1 &= ~UCSWRST; //初始化 USCI_A0 状态机
IE2 |= UCA0RXIE; //使能 USCI_A0 接收中断
_EINT(); //开总中断
while(1)
{
}
}
#pragma vector = USCIAB0RX_VECTOR //接收中断
__interrupt void USCI0RX_ISR(void)
{
while ( !(IFG2&UCA0TXIFG) ); //确保发送缓冲区准备好
P1OUT ^= BIT0; //接收指示灯状态改变
UCA0TXBUF = UCA0RXBUF; //发送接收到的数据
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2015-03-24 10:33 ju\
文件 156 2015-03-24 10:17 ju\data.eww
目录 0 2015-03-20 11:02 ju\Debug\
目录 0 2015-03-20 11:05 ju\Debug\Exe\
文件 16198 2015-03-24 10:17 ju\Debug\Exe\ju.d43
目录 0 2015-03-20 11:02 ju\Debug\List\
目录 0 2015-03-24 10:33 ju\Debug\Obj\
文件 127 2015-03-24 10:33 ju\Debug\Obj\ju.pbd
文件 414 2015-03-24 10:33 ju\Debug\Obj\main.pbi
文件 7586 2015-03-24 10:17 ju\Debug\Obj\main.r43
文件 2685 2015-03-24 10:19 ju\ju.dep
文件 20124 2015-03-24 10:17 ju\ju.ewd
文件 50201 2015-03-20 11:04 ju\ju.ewp
文件 156 2015-03-20 11:04 ju\ju.eww
文件 1150 2015-03-24 10:16 ju\main.c
文件 0 2015-03-24 10:17 ju\path.txt
目录 0 2015-03-24 10:17 ju\settings\
文件 3797 2015-03-24 10:19 ju\settings\data.wsdt
文件 1253 2015-03-24 10:33 ju\settings\ju.cspy.bat
文件 3935 2015-03-24 10:19 ju\settings\ju.dbgdt
文件 1252 2015-03-24 10:19 ju\settings\ju.dni
文件 4241 2015-03-20 21:24 ju\settings\ju.wsdt
相关资源
- 基于MSP430G2553的蓝牙控制小车
- MSP430G2553以4线SPI方式控制0.96寸OLED
- MSP430G2553快速入门教程
- 基于MSP430G2553的简易频率计
- 基于MSP430的万年历资料
- MSP430G2553_LauchPad及IAR和Proteus使用指南
- MSP430G2553及扩展板使用指导书及例程从
- 基于MSP430G2553和NRF24L01的DS1302时钟程序
- msp430g2553中文数据手册.pdf
- MSP430G2553的时钟系统初始化及PWM的呼吸
- MSP430g2553单片机实现的输出三路PWM,
- ssd1306驱动12864OLED显示屏msp430g2553函数
- msp430G2553的4*4矩阵键盘程序文本
- MSP430G2553的8*8点阵
- msp430g2553控制的简易交通灯
- msp430g2553 AD采集 单通道多次采集
- MSP430G2553 DAC+ADC 简单应用,用nokia 51
- 基于MSP430G2553的电压表设计
- msp430G2553测各种波形的频率和幅度并显
- msp430g2553温度光照强度的测试与无线传
- msp430g2553和LCD12864的串行显示代码
- msp430G25532 程序代码全
- G2553 12864的程序
- 基于msp430g2553的矩阵键盘
- 用430控制ADS8361的程序
- MSP430G2553 FLASH读写
- 基于ti 的单片机msp430g2553的硬件spi控制
- DHT11 430程序
- MSP430G2系列代码(含MSP430G2553) Code
- msp430g2553内置FLash使用
评论
共有 条评论